Metal directed assembly of ditopic containers and their complexes with alkylammonium salts
Edoardo Menozzi1, Julius Rebek
1Skaggs Institute for Chemical Biology and Department of Chemistry, Scripps Research Institute, MB-26, La Jolla, California 92037, USA.
Abstract:
A new self-folding cavitand has been assembled through metal coordination to give a thermodynamically stable ditopic receptor of nanosize dimensions which has been used in the reversible binding of di-alkylammonium and n-alkylammonium salts.
